As of March 2025, the average annual salary for employees at Asset Financial Center in the United States is $88,678.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$43. Salaries at Asset Financial Center typically range from $77,999 to $100,513 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Individual sal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as job role, experience, education level, certifications, and more. At Asset Financial Center, a FT Corporate Recruiter (2210) is among the highest earners, with an average salary of approximately $243,751 per year. Conversely, the lowest-paid position is Home Health Aide, earning around $29,942 annually. Explore this page further for more salary and benefits information at Asset Financial Center.
